Energy Efficiency
By replacing your single-pane windows with new double-glazed windows, you will increase the efficiency of your home and save on your energy bills. Double-glazed windows are more energy efficient and prevent your home from losing warmth in winter and getting it back in summer. This means that you do not have to spend more on heating or cooling.
Additionally, double glazed windows have seals to keep out pollutants and dust. This helps you maintain your home in a pleasant environment while preventing the harsh climate of Melbourne from impacting your home. The insulation also helps keep out cold air in winter and hot weather in summer.
A double-glazed window is a unit of two insulated glass panes that are sealed hermetically together with spacers, as well as other components. They create an air pocket between the two glass panes, which acts as an insulator. The air pocket can be filled with various gases, such as Krypton or argon.
They are more effective in reducing heat loss compared to typical aluminum-framed single-pane windows. According to the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) it is possible to save up to $17,490 over 30 years when you replace your single-pane windows new double-pane windows certified by Energy Star.
You can pick from a wide range of double-glazed windows that are energy efficient. Some of them cut down on energy consumption and costs by using low emissivity coatings to reduce the amount of heat that is transferred through the window. You can also get windows that are insulated with cladding which makes them more energy efficient.

Be aware that you may require permission to plan if you are replacing single-glazed with double-glazed windows. Double-glazed frames are typically thicker and alter the look of a house dramatically.

Double-pane windows' price can vary depending on the design and frame material you choose. Typically, fiberglass frames are the most affordable. They are also sturdy and energy efficient. Wood-framed windows are more expensive however they provide better insulation than vinyl. They are also more durable and require less maintenance than aluminum-framed windows.
The size of the double-pane windows and the way it is installed are also factors that impact the price. If you are replacing windows that are of similar size, the cost will be less. If you're looking to alter the size of your windows, the cost will be more expensive.

Double-pane windows are also known as insulated glass units (IGUs). They are composed of two glass panes that are separated by an inert gas, such as nitrogen, krypton, or even argon to increase energy efficiency. As compared to single-pane windows they are more energy efficient, aid to cut down on heating and cooling bills as well as reduce condensation, minimize outside noise pollution, and lessen carbon emissions. Window replacement is a low-cost way to improve the comfort of a home. Double-paned windows are more efficient than single-paned windows. They can reduce the loss of heat in the winter, and cooling costs in summer. They also help reduce outside noise pollution. Double-paned windows protect interior furnishings from the sun’s harmful ultraviolet radiation.
The cost of replacing a double-pane windows can vary depending on what kind of glass you choose. Double-pane windows that have low-e coating or gas fills are more expensive than standard double-pane windows however they offer additional insulation and a higher efficiency in energy use. In summer, conventional windows let 75% of the sunlight into the home, which can lead to uncomfortable temperatures and high cooling bills. However, ENERGY STAR certified double-pane windows significantly reduce the amount of heat that enters your home, but still allow plenty of sunlight.

The most significant factor that affects the price of double-pane windows is the window frame material, which impacts the cost, insulating properties, maintenance levels and durability. Vinyl is the cheapest alternative, whereas wood frames are more durable but require more maintenance and could be expensive.
